Smart, budget hotel. I think it was newly renovated or built. I found the hotel, room and bathroom clean and hygienic. No smell or odor which usually you find in an old or rundown hotel. Furniture was also clean and not rundown with a small working area and chair. Several power sockets in the room however all American sockets, you can ask the reception to provide you an adaptor, if available they will give you one, I did and received one which I returned at check-out. The hotel offers breakfast from 7:00 - 10:00 a.m. and refreshments from 5:00 - 7:00 p.m. (if my memory serves me right). Both were included in my room but unfortunately I did not try since I prefer to explore the local restaurants. You can also find coffee machine, water from fountain etc. at the restaurant area which you can access all times. No coffee machine in the room. The room has a small, drawer refrigerator you can use for drinks. Excellent location: If this is your first time in Manhattan and you plan to explore primarily Manhattan, this is an excellent location close to almost all subway lines. Central park is at two blocks distance. The street is not noisy. The room was small considering I live in Middle East and here the hotels rooms are quit large and spacious. But I believe the hotel and rooms were designed by NYC standards.

Fortunately for me, everything turned out to be very positive. Considering which part of the world you come from, you can find some people of NYC to be rude but in my case I found the hotel staff to be very kind and polite in all my communications. I even asked the lady at the reception do I need to take any precautions considering rising crime rate in NYC, she gave me some useful tips.

This is a very nice new hotel right behind Carnegie Hall. Location is excellent, rooms are new and clean if a bit small, and free continental breakfast, snacks and evening wine are offered in the small common area on the ground floor. Pricing is reasonable compared to other hotels in the area.

The hotel is fit into a tight space and everything inside feels a bit jammed. Lobby and common areas are small, as are hallways on each floor. On the other hand that means only 4 (?) rooms per floor so quiet. Rooms are very nice if a bit small, best for business travelers without a lot of luggage. Bathrooms are a decent size.

This charming European-style hotel is new to us and is now our go-to place for the Central Park South area. Sandwiched between two larger buildings it has only six rooms per floor, small but very comfortable in the European modern mode. Excellent pillows. Right across the street from the stage door entry to Carnegie Hall, there are numerous good restaurants within easy walking distance at a range of price points from reasonable for the area to stupid expensive. Included continental breakfast and wine bar. The staff is welcoming and admirably well-trained.

The breakfast/lounge area is small and struggles to keep up with the traffic at breakfast and happy hour but they don't have much real estate to work with. Anything can be taken to go or back to your room.

When are the check-in and check-out times for Carnegie Hotel?

Carnegie Hotel permits check-ins after 04:00 PM and expects check-outs to be completed by 12:00 PM.

Is vehicle parking offered by Carnegie Hotel?

Yes, parking is available at the Carnegie Hotel. It is a public parking facility located nearby the hotel. The cost for parking is $52 per day, and there is no need to make a reservation in advance.
